Traditionally RCA analogue inputs have been the most popular, for plugging in turntables and CD players, and all stereo and AV models sport these. More recently, digital inputs such as coaxial and optical have become far more common allowing for digital components like streamers to be easily connected. The hottest input these days, however, would definitely be HDMI ARC which allows you the freedom of connecting a TV to your stereo or surround sound system for much better sound and the convenience of using your TV remote to control volume, like the Denon AVC-A10H Amplifier.
